Who needs soft tissue moulage?

01
Soft tissue moulage is commonly used by various professionals, including:
02
- Medical training institutions and simulation centers: to teach and practice medical procedures or emergency scenarios.
03
- Special effects and makeup artists: to create realistic wounds, injuries, or prosthetics for movies, TV shows, or theatrical productions.
04
- Forensic investigators: to recreate crime scenes or simulate injuries for investigative purposes.
05
- Military and law enforcement: to train personnel in medical triage, battlefield medicine, or simulated combat scenarios.
06
- Medical professionals: to enhance patient education or demonstrate medical conditions and injuries.
07
- First aid and CPR instructors: to simulate wounds or injuries during training sessions.
